How it works-
Levocetirizine and Montelukast are both included in Breaze-L KID Tablet DT. These two works together to lessen the sneezing and runny nose brought on by allergies. Levocetirizine, an antihistamine, blocks the chemical messenger histamine, which results in runny noses, watery eyes, and sneezing. A leukotriene antagonist, montelukast. It functions by obstructing leukotriene, another chemical messenger.

Breaze L Kid Tablet comprises the anti-allergic medications Levocetirizine and Montelukast. Levocetirizine is an antihistamine (allergy medication) that inhibits the effects of a chemical messenger (histamine) that is normally implicated in allergic responses. As a result, it alleviates allergy symptoms including sneezing, runny nose, watery eyes, itching, swelling, congestion, or stiffness. The leukotriene antagonist Montelukast, on the other hand, reduces swelling and inflammation in the nose and lungs to make breathing easier. It does this by inhibiting the chemical messenger leukotriene. Both of them work together to alleviate symptoms and treat a wide range of allergic conditions, reducing symptoms such as sneezing, runny nose, coughing, watery eyes, and so on.
